Output 1ebf2bfa52373be59e93c9994b94e288a5d6c3ad9598d706ea86ef749c56b2b8:5

value
19777827
script pubkey
OP_0 OP_PUSHBYTES_20 5768d2cd145ff9281d9c64652d043a84a23a4def
address
bc1q2a5d9ng5tlujs8vuv3jj6pp6sj3r5n00hccw8g
transaction
1ebf2bfa52373be59e93c9994b94e288a5d6c3ad9598d706ea86ef749c56b2b8
spent
true